What Is A Dry Socket After Tooth Extraction?
A dry socket is a painful dental condition occurring when a blood clot fails to develop or dislodges from an extraction site. Normally, a blood clot forms to protect the underlying bone and nerve endings in the empty tooth socket. This protective layer is essential for proper healing and tissue regeneration.
When this clot goes missing, the sensitive bone and nerves become exposed to the oral environment. Exposure leads to intense pain that radiates along the jaw and face. Saliva, food particles, and bacteria can easily enter the empty space and cause further irritation. This condition disrupts the natural healing process significantly. Patients require specific dental interventions to soothe the area and promote secondary healing mechanisms.
What Are The Primary Causes Of Dry Socket?
The primary causes of a dry socket involve trauma to the extraction site, bacterial infections, and the physical dislodgment of the protective blood clot. Difficult or complicated tooth removals naturally create more trauma in the surrounding jawbone and gum tissue. This excessive trauma interferes with normal blood clotting mechanisms right from the start. Pre-existing bacterial infections in the mouth can also prevent a proper clot from forming. Physical actions like vigorous rinsing or spitting create negative pressure inside the oral cavity. This pressure easily pulls a newly formed clot out of its delicate position. Poor oral hygiene leaves harmful bacteria near the surgical site, breaking down the clot prematurely. Hormonal changes, particularly high estrogen levels, further disrupt the stabilization of this crucial blood clot.
How Long After An Extraction Does Dry Socket Occur?
A dry socket typically develops within three to five days following a tooth extraction procedure. The initial days after oral surgery are critical for the formation and stabilization of the blood clot. Patients usually experience a gradual decrease in normal post-operative pain during the first two days. However, if the clot fails or dislodges, a sudden and severe onset of pain begins on the third or fourth day. This timeline is a definitive marker distinguishing normal recovery from a complication.
The blood clot is most vulnerable during this specific window of time. Once the first week passes without incident, the risk of developing this painful complication decreases significantly. The socket tissue begins to granulate and heal safely after this period.
What Are The Most Common Symptoms Of This Condition?
The most common symptoms of a dry socket manifest as intense localized pain and visible physical changes in the extraction area.
- Severe throbbing pain that frequently radiates towards the ear, eye, or temple on the same side.
- Partial or total absence of the dark blood clot usually seen at the extraction site.
- Visible white bone tissue directly exposed at the bottom of the empty tooth socket.
- A persistently foul taste in the mouth that does not improve with basic oral hygiene.
- Noticeable bad breath originating from the bacteria accumulating inside the healing area.
- Increased discomfort when cold air or liquids pass over the unprotected nerve endings.
How Does A Dental Professional Diagnose A Dry Socket?
A dental professional diagnoses a dry socket by reviewing the patient symptom history and performing a visual clinical examination of the extraction site.
The diagnostic process begins with a discussion about the timeline and intensity of the pain experienced. The dentist visually inspects the empty socket to check for a missing blood clot. Finding exposed bone instead of dark coagulated blood strongly confirms the presence of this condition. The practitioner also evaluates the area for potential signs of deeper infections or trapped food debris. Sometimes, dental x-rays are taken to rule out other complications like remaining root fragments or bone fractures. This comprehensive evaluation ensures the severe pain is solely caused by the missing clot. Accurate diagnosis dictates the appropriate palliative care required for tissue recovery.
What Treatment Options Are Available For Dry Socket?
Treatment options for a dry socket focus on pain relief through gentle irrigation and the application of medicated dressings inside the wound.
The dentist first flushes the empty socket with saline solution to remove irritating food particles and bacteria. After cleaning the area, a special medicated paste or dressing is carefully packed into the socket. This dressing contains soothing ingredients like eugenol, which instantly numbs the exposed nerve endings. Patients experience significant pain reduction shortly after this specialized dressing is placed. The dressing requires replacement every few days until the pain subsides completely. Dentists may also prescribe oral pain relievers and antibacterial mouthwashes to support the healing phase. These combined therapies effectively manage discomfort while the socket heals naturally from the bottom up.
How Long Does It Take For A Dry Socket To Heal?
A dry socket typically takes between seven to ten days to heal completely once proper treatment is initiated.
The healing process begins as new granulation tissue slowly forms over the exposed bone. Proper medical dressings accelerate comfort, but tissue regeneration requires biological time to complete. Patients notice a gradual decrease in throbbing pain daily as the exposed nerves become covered. Adhering strictly to post-operative care instructions ensures the new tissue remains undisturbed. Any disruption to this fragile new tissue extends the overall recovery timeline significantly. Complete closure of the gum tissue over the extraction site may take several weeks. However, the acute pain phase associated with the exposed bone resolves within that initial ten-day period.
What Pain Management Strategies Work For Dry Socket?
Effective pain management strategies for a dry socket combine professionally applied medicated dressings with over-the-counter nonsteroidal anti-inflammatory drugs.
The medicated packing placed by a dentist remains the most effective method for immediate local pain relief. For systemic relief, ibuprofen or naproxen sodium significantly reduces inflammation around the affected jaw area. Cold compresses applied to the outside of the face during the first forty-eight hours minimize swelling. After two days, switching to warm compresses helps relax tense facial muscles caused by severe pain. Keeping the head elevated while sleeping prevents blood from pooling in the head, reducing throbbing sensations. Gentle warm saltwater rinses soothe the inflamed gums without dislodging any healing tissues.
How Can Patients Prevent Dry Socket From Developing?
Patients prevent a dry socket by avoiding negative pressure in the mouth and maintaining excellent but gentle oral hygiene.
Strictly following all post-operative instructions is the foundation of preventing extraction complications. Patients must completely avoid spitting forcefully or rinsing vigorously during the first few days of recovery. Chewing on the opposite side of the mouth protects the fragile blood clot from mechanical damage. Soft food diets prevent hard or crunchy particles from embedding into the healing surgical site. Maintaining good oral hygiene involves gently brushing teeth while carefully avoiding the immediate extraction area. Resting and avoiding strenuous physical activities keeps blood pressure stable, preventing post-operative bleeding. These careful measures ensure the blood clot remains securely in place during critical early healing.
Can Smoking Increase The Risk Of Dry Socket?
Smoking significantly increases the risk of a dry socket by introducing harmful chemicals and creating negative pressure in the oral cavity.
The physical act of inhaling cigarette smoke creates a strong suction force inside the mouth. This suction easily pulls the newly formed blood clot directly out of the tooth socket. Furthermore, tobacco products contain numerous toxic chemicals that severely decrease blood supply to the healing gums. Reduced blood flow deprives the extraction site of essential oxygen and nutrients required for tissue repair. This restricted circulation makes clot formation much more difficult and fragile from the beginning. Dentists strongly advise suspending all tobacco use for at least seventy-two hours following any dental extraction. Avoiding smoke completely provides the best environment for uncomplicated healing.
Does Using A Straw Cause Dry Socket Complications?
Using a straw creates dangerous negative pressure inside the mouth that frequently causes dry socket complications by dislodging the blood clot.
The mechanics of drinking through a tube require the facial muscles to create a vacuum effect. This powerful suction force acts directly against the delicate blood clot resting in the extraction site. Even a slight vacuum can effortlessly pull the clot away from the bone and nerve endings. Once the clot is removed, the healing process halts immediately, and severe pain ensues. Patients must drink liquids directly from a regular cup or glass to eliminate this mechanical risk entirely. Avoiding straws for a full week post-surgery allows the extraction site to stabilize and begin granulating safely.
Are Wisdom Teeth Extractions More Prone To Dry Socket?
Wisdom teeth extractions are significantly more prone to dry socket formation due to the complex nature and location of the surgery.
These third molars are located in the dense bone of the lower jaw with limited blood supply. Lower jaw extractions generally experience a much higher complication rate compared to upper jaw procedures. Wisdom teeth often require surgical sectioning and bone removal, causing extensive local tissue trauma. This increased surgical trauma makes stabilizing a solid blood clot substantially more difficult. The posterior location also makes keeping the area clean from food debris extremely challenging for patients. The combination of dense bone, high trauma, and difficult hygiene creates an ideal environment for blood clot failure.
When Should A Patient Contact A Dentist Immediately?
A patient should contact a dentist immediately if severe pain develops days after the extraction or if pain medications become ineffective.
Normal extraction discomfort peaks on the second day and steadily improves throughout the week. An abrupt increase in intense, throbbing pain on the third or fourth day signals a clear complication. Any visible signs of bright red bleeding that cannot be controlled with gentle gauze pressure require attention. The sudden onset of a foul odor or an excessively bad taste strongly indicates a disrupted healing process. Developing a high fever or experiencing newly swollen lymph nodes points toward a potential spreading bacterial infection. Prompt professional evaluation prevents further tissue damage and provides rapid relief for the patient.
What Foods Should Be Avoided To Prevent Dry Socket?
Patients should strictly avoid hard, crunchy, sticky, and spicy foods to prevent a dry socket during the initial healing phase.
Foods like nuts, chips, and popcorn break down into sharp fragments during the chewing process. These rigid pieces easily lodge directly into the empty socket, irritating the wound and displacing the clot. Sticky candies or chewy meats create a vacuum effect when chewed, pulling at the fragile healing tissues. Spicy and highly acidic foods severely irritate the raw, exposed gums, causing unnecessary burning sensations. Hot beverages dissolve the forming blood clot before it fully stabilizes within the bony socket structure. Consuming a strictly soft, lukewarm diet ensures the surgical site remains clean, undisturbed, and capable of proper regeneration.
